When doing an inventory adjsutment to move stock between locations, an error occured telling the value of the inventory for G00636 could not be less than zero. Somehow it recorded but put the inventory adjustment to Cost of Goods. How do I fix this ? No matter what I try it tells me the value of my inventory may not be less than zero.

The error itself simply means the transactions you are trying to record will reduce the item value by a figure higher than its current value (item card > profile > current value), as item values cannot be negative the error will prevent the transaction from being recorded. Looking at the first screenshot, the first line shows item G00636 location ENK had a 1451 quantity taken out but no Amount (item value) was reduced, this would be why the transaction was able to be recorded.
If you are merely moving stock between locations without value gain/loss, I'd suggest recording a Move Items transaction instead, please find the instructions in this Help article: Move items between locations. Are you able to delete the inventory adjustment now and record it as Move Items?
